Output 63a264cf4d2149dd0e8c9413a6f309c61ba6658194b88eb0061e2833e1184625:1

value
2795720
script pubkey
OP_0 OP_PUSHBYTES_20 7d66f74a816218c4081a8d53e06810d91da2275a
address
ltc1q04n0wj5pvgvvgzq634f7q6qsmyw6yf66ajetw8
transaction
63a264cf4d2149dd0e8c9413a6f309c61ba6658194b88eb0061e2833e1184625
spent
true